Your impact as a fashion influencer hinges not just on style but also on how you present it. In today's digital landscape, creating eye-catching content is crucial. Fashion videos are your canvas. What tools do you need to make them pop?
Lighting: Bright, flattering light can transform a simple outfit showcase into a captivating visual story. Invest in ring lights or softbox lights to mimic natural daylight. When filming indoors, position your setup near windows for a gorgeous glow that enhances every detail of your attire.
Capturing Crystal-Clear Audio
Imagine shooting a stunning video, only to have your voice drowned out by background noise. Yikes. To prevent this, a quality microphone is non-negotiable. Consider a wireless lapel mic for TikTok snippets or a shotgun mic for expansive Instagram Reels. On YouTube Shorts, where longer narratives can unfold, clarity is essential.
Your Visual Aesthetic: The Right Camera
Your smartphone can be your best asset, especially with models boasting advanced lenses and AI capabilities. However, if you're serious about your fashion brand, a DSLR or mirrorless camera can elevate your production level significantly. They offer versatility and image quality that truly captures intricate designs and textures.
Choosing the Perfect Backdrop
Have you thought about your backdrop? It speaks volumes about your content. Consider shooting against colorful murals or lush greenery for an Instagram aesthetic. For more professional settings, seamless paper backgrounds can add a touch of sophistication to your YouTube Shorts.
- Tip: Choose locations that resonate with your brand’s identity. A bohemian-style influencer might thrive in an earthy, natural setting.Tip: Always scout locations ahead of time to ensure they match your vision.
Creative Editing Tools
Editing isn't just fluff; it's the magic that turns raw footage into compelling storytelling. Apps like InShot and CapCut are user-friendly and packed with features tailored for fashion content. Employ trendy transitions, catchy beats, and bold text overlays to captivate your audience.
Music: The Heartbeat of Your Video
Adding the right soundtrack is essential. Instagram and TikTok offer vast libraries of music that resonate with your fashion aesthetic. Pick tracks that elicit an emotional response, enhancing viewer engagement. For YouTube Shorts, ensure you adhere to copyright regulations. Use royalty-free music to avoid takedowns.
Structuring Content for Maximum Engagement
How do you draw viewers into your world? Short, snappy videos work wonders on TikTok, promoting engagement through trending challenges. On Instagram, consider 'Get Ready With Me' formats that integrate storytelling with outfit showcases. Meanwhile, YouTube Shorts thrive on quick DIY tips or transformative before-and-after segments.
Utilizing Hashtags Effectively
Visibility is key. Research trending hashtags in the fashion niche and incorporate both popular and niche-specific tags. For instance, use hashtags like #OOTD for outfit inspiration, but don’t shy away from more specific tags, like #SustainableFashion to target eco-conscious audiences.
Engaging Your Audience
Building a community around your brand enriches your influence. Regularly interact with your followers via comments or live Q&A sessions. Consider collaborations with other influencers or brands to cross-pollinate audiences. This strategy not only expands your visibility but also enriches your content with diverse perspectives.
Creating a Content Calendar
Consistency is key in fashion influencer success. Develop a content calendar to keep your uploads timely and relevant. Include seasonal themes, holidays, or upcoming fashion weeks to keep your audience anticipating your next post. This structured approach simplifies your workflow and maintains engagement.
